The year is winding down, after tonight’s contest only eleven more games will remain. If you’d asked me in February, I would have expressed nothing but gratitude for the Rockets season coming to a merciful conclusion. This newer, peppier, more coherent Rockets team is actually the sort of thing I thought I’d be watching all season, so I’m not sure I want to give it up, and focus on draft picks. But that’s going to happen anyway.

Anyhow, the Rockets take on the Pelicans again in a Bayou Two Step. The Pelicans have plummeted from NBA skies and are now looking for trash fish in the estuaries of the Gulf. The last game ended with Jabari Smith Jr canning a contested 3pt shot for the win. Let’s do it again.
